Job Description: As a Federal Systems Integrator Leader at HPE, you will be at the forefront of advancing national security, government, and defense initiatives. Your leadership will be instrumental in shaping strategic partnerships, driving innovative solutions, and delivering exceptional results for our federal customers. Your Role: As a key leader, you will guide our federal sales community to success by setting clear strategic direction aligned with HPE’s vision and mission. You will inspire and develop a high-performing team, orchestrate large-scale enterprise-level engagements, and foster trusted relationships with federal stakeholders, including senior government officials. You will manage the full sales lifecycle—from identifying opportunities and building early-stage relationships with top government executives to closing complex deals that meet technical, budgetary, and strategic goals. Your expertise will enable your team to craft tailored IT investments, solutions, and pricing strategies that align with federal mission priorities.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ree or higher; advanced degrees or certifications in relevant fields are a plus.
  • 10+ years of experience in federal sales, business development, or systems integration, with a proven track record of winning large, complex government contracts.
  • 5+ years of leadership experience managing high-performing teams within the federal sector.
  • Security Clearance required.
  • Deep understanding of federal procurement processes, compliance standards, and security protocols.
  • Expertise in federal IT priorities, including cloud, cybersecurity, data center modernization, and advanced infrastructure solutions.
  • Strong strategic thinking, executive relationship management, and negotiation skills.
  • Ability to navigate complex multi-stakeholder environments and influence at the highest levels.
